Key Facts

  • siegenite's instance of is recorded as mineral species[3].
  • Siegerland is named after siegenite[4].
  • siegenite's chemical formula is recorded as CoNi₂S₄[5].
  • siegenite is a type of linnaeite mineral group[6].
  • siegenite's Commons category is recorded as Siegenite[7].
  • siegenite's crystal system is recorded as cubic crystal system[8].
  • siegenite's IMA status and/or rank is recorded as grandfathered mineral (G)[9].
  • siegenite's space group is recorded as space group Fd-3m[10].
  • siegenite's Strunz 8th edition is recorded as II/C.01[11].
  • siegenite's Nickel-Strunz 9th edition is recorded as 2.DA.05[12].
  • siegenite's Nickel-Strunz '10th ed', review of is recorded as 2.DA.05[13].
  • siegenite's described by source is recorded as A System of Mineralogy, 3rd edition[14].
  • siegenite's IMA Mineral Symbol is recorded as Seg[15].
